Emil Heineman Back in Action for Canadiens
One piece of good news for the Canadiens is the return of forward Emil Heineman. After being sidelined for 14 games, Heineman is back in the lineup, bringing his energy and skill to the ice. Heineman himself expressed his frustration with missing those games, especially since he felt he was developing good chemistry with linemates Jake Evans and Joel Armia. As reported by La Presse, Heineman was eager to rejoin the team and contribute.

A Legacy of Excellence
The Montreal Canadiens, affectionately known as the Habs, are more than just a hockey team; they're a symbol of pride and passion for the city of Montreal and for fans across Canada. Officially known as the Club de hockey Canadien, the team boasts a storied history, filled with legendary players and unforgettable moments.
Founded in 1909, the Canadiens are one of the "Original Six" teams of the NHL and have won a record 24 Stanley Cups. Their iconic red, white, and blue jerseys are instantly recognizable, and their home games at the Bell Centre are known for their electric atmosphere.
Cultural Significance
The Canadiens hold a special place in Quebec culture. The team represents a sense of identity and unity for many French-Canadians, and their success has often been seen as a source of pride for the province. The rivalry with the Toronto Maple Leafs is one of the most intense and enduring in all of sports, reflecting the historical and cultural differences between English and French Canada.
